How to make it
- Pastry Shell
- Mix together all ingredients
- roll out like a pie dough
- Cut to be about the size of a cupcake shell
- mold the dough into cupcake pan that has been lightly sprayed with cooking spray (I like bakers joy for this recipe)
- Once all the shells have been placed into the cupcake pans, drop 1/2 teaspoon of jelly into the bottom of each shell
- Cake filling
- Mix cake mix according to box, adding the above additional ingredients
- Spoon cake into the shells with the jelly.
- Fill as you would a cupcake, about 3/4 ways full
- Bake at 350 for about 30 min
- Tops should be a dark golden brown
- Allow to cool till the cake feels cool to the touch.
- Slip a knife in besides each cake to help lift it out and finish cooling completely
- White icing
- Mix all icing ingredients together, adding water one tablespoon at a time until the icing is nice and creamy.
- If it is too funny, just add powdered sugar to it
- Spread icing on each of the cakes and allow the icing to harden
- Fern design
- With the remaining icing add some cocoa powder to give it a rich chocolate color and taste.
- Using a plastic baggie, put icing in bag, snip off a small piece of the corner of baggie.
- Pipe a vertical line down the center of the icing
- Now place two V's over the chocolate line to make what looks like a tree (fern)
